Residents of St. Louis County, the City of St. Louis, St. Charles County, Jefferson County, and Franklin County will have an opportunity to weigh in on state plans to get every Missourian online when officials from the Missouri Office of Broadband Development visit the Grand Glaize Branch of the St. Louis County Library on Wednesday, November 16 from 2-4:00 p.m.
